Abstract

The arrangement, for taking separate successive samples of urine from a patient for subsequent laboratory analysis in respect of bacterial content etc., separates urine flow into three separate sections ready for transportation to the laboratory. A fitment (1) with a sealing strip (2) is attached to the seated patient, the fitment having an outlet (1a) for urine flow, which is connected to a rigid branched connecting piece (3). Urine first flows into a flexible shaped tube (4) with a free end whose top is sealed with wadding (5) and is physically higher than the rest of the device. When the U-shaped tube is so full that the level of urine is above the branch (3c) of the rigid connecting piece, flow proceeds down a vertical tube (6) with a U-shaped end into a spherical container (7), which has a breather tube (8). When the spherical container is full, the U-shaped end piece of the vertical tube acts as the holder for the third sect-on of the urine sample.
